Model: Tapo P300  
Hardware Version: V1
Firmware Version: 3.9.110

Hi,

I just installed the multiplug. Everythihng is up and running, latest fireware installed, but, I did some testing and I have a mismatch between the plug and the app info : I can turn off one of the plugs wether I'm on the same network or not (or even just on 4G), so that's fine. But few seconds (minutes) later, the plug is showing as "on" in the app when in reality, it's not. And this behavior happens wether I'm on the same network or not. I have to tap the plug again (in the app), so it shows as offline, and then tap again so it actually reactivate the plug concretly....

If the app shows the plug as online when in fact it's off, that's a problem....

Anything you can help me with ?

Check the network connection on your phone, when using the Tapo app, disable the VPN or any VPN-based apps if any. Try to delete and reinstall the app. 

 

Is your home network and the sim card from the same Internet provider? If it is the same one, try to test this problem under a different provider's network. For example, you can connect the WiFi from a coffee shop, company, mall, etc.

 

Does this occur on another mobile device?

Thanks, that was it ! I was using a VPN on my phone... I don't get how it could jeopardize the reading of the plug status though, but, when I turn it off, it works.....
